diff --git a/core/lib/Drupal/Core/Config/Config.php b/core/lib/Drupal/Core/Config/Config.php index 00acba0b04..5356ed966b 100644 --- a/core/lib/Drupal/Core/Config/Config.php +++ b/core/lib/Drupal/Core/Config/Config.php @@ -316,7 +316,7 @@ public function getOriginal($key = '', $apply_overrides = TRUE) { */ public function hasOverrides($key = '') { if (empty($key)) { - return (!empty($this->moduleOverrides) && is_array($this->moduleOverrides)) || (!empty($this->settingsOverrides) && is_array($this->settingsOverrides)); + return !(empty($this->moduleOverrides) && empty($this->settingsOverrides)); } else { $parts = explode('.', $key);